CANTALOUPE BREAD WITH PRALINE GLAZE

This excellent bread is very moist and has the texture of pumpkin or zucchini bread. Can puree and freeze extra cantaloupe to make bread in the off season.

Time 1h15m

Yield 20

Number Of Ingredients 14

3 eggs
1 cup vegetable oil
2 cups white sugar
1 tablespoon vanilla extract
2 cups cantaloupe - peeled, seeded and pureed
3 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on baking soda
¾ teaspoon baking powder
2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
½ teaspoon ground ginger
½ cup butter
1 ⅔ cups brown sugar
½ cup chopped pecans

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). Lightly grease and flour two 9x5 inch loaf pans.
  • In a large bowl, beat together eggs, vegetable, sugar, vanilla and cantaloupe. In a separate bowl, sift together flour, salt, baking soda, baking powder, cinnamon and ginger. Stir flour mixture into cantaloupe mixture; stir to combine. Pour batter into prepared pans.
  • Bake in preheated oven for 1 hour, until a toothpick inserted into center of a loaf comes out clean. Meanwhile, combine margarine and brown sugar. Microwave for 3 minutes, stirring at 1 minute intervals; mix in pecans. Pour sauce over warm bread. Let cool for 1 hour before serving.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 366.1 calories, Carbohydrate 48.2 g, Cholesterol 40.1 mg, Fat 18.4 g, Fiber 1 g, Protein 3.3 g, SaturatedFat 5.1 g, Sodium 242.2 mg, Sugar 33.2 g
